Assistant Professor
-
Jun 2021 - Sep 2023
Conducting research on the cognitive science of belief, imagination, and social bonding, to answer the following research questions: (1) How do cognitive antecedents and other individual differences combine with cultural and social contexts to give rise to beliefs - whether religious, secular, or conspiracy beliefs? (2) How do extraordinary experiences invoke social bonding, and how does social bonding contributes to psychological wellbeing and health behaviours? (3) How can we understand the cognitive features of imagination (e.g., cognitive flexibility) and its evolutionary trajectory (particularly in relation to religion and art)? Show less

Research Fellow
-
Aug 2019 - May 2021
Conducting research on how psychedelic use may contribute to greater empathetic concern for others; how engaging in rituals together may increase endorphins and social bonding in both religious and secular settings; how attending raves together can be a transformative experience leading to long-lasting bonds; the psychological impact of the COVID-19 lockdown and how this may be mitigated.
